@techreport{oai:ir.ide.go.jp:00037960, author = {Uchimura, Hiroko and Suzuki, Yurika}, month = {Jul}, note = {application/pdf, IDP000209_001, This paper focuses on the fiscal decentralization in the Philippines after the 1991 Local Government Code. It first examines the intergovernmental fiscal relationship between central and local governments by using fiscal decentralization indicators, and then investigates its impact on local finance. After fiscal decentralization, the local expenditure responsibility is expanded while the local fiscal capacity is not strengthened in the Philippines. Local governments consequently comes to depend heavily on fiscal transfers from the central government, internal revenue allotments (IRAs), which has a substantial influence on local finance. The heavy dependence on IRAs makes local finance unpredictable and unstable. The distribution of IRAs also affects the horizontal balance between provincial governments.}, title = {Measuring Fiscal Decentralization in the Philippines}, year = {2009} }
